Restoring Your Ride: Original vs. OEM Hubcaps



When reviving your classic vehicle, the fine points extends to every component . Hubcaps, often overlooked , play a significant role in the overall aesthetic . Choosing between authentic hubcaps and Original Equipment Manufacturer replacements can be a complex decision. Original hubcaps are the identical ones that were provided with the car from the dealership, adding character and potentially increasing its market value. However, they can be scarce and often show wear . OEM hubcaps, while not the original article, are created to the factory’s design, offering a more budget-friendly and easily sourced alternative while still maintaining a period-correct impression.

The History of Wheel Covers : A Classic Automotive Tale



From their humble beginnings in the early 20th time, trim rings have undergone a fascinating evolution . Initially, they were basic metal plates designed to shield the exposed wheel rims and mask the often-unattractive fasteners. Early models were frequently practical , lacking the ornate designs we connect with later years. As automotive design 17 Inch became increasingly significant during the 1930s and 40s, hubcaps started to showcase the age's artistic tastes . Manufacturers introduced polished finishes and more complex motifs . The 1950s and 60s saw a boom in inventive wheel cover design , with several distinctive shapes and symbols becoming representative of the automotive vista.

Replacing Your Hubcaps: A Step-by-Step DIY Guide



Swapping out your old hubcaps is a relatively straightforward job that can save your budget and improve your vehicle’s look . Here’s a simple guide to walk you through the process . First, collect your supplies, which typically involve a flat tool, a rubber hammer and possibly a hoist and support stands if your ride is low to the ground. Gently pop the hubcap loose from the rim , using the screwdriver to disengage the clips . If the hubcap is tight , a soft tap with the rubber mallet can assist . Once released, take the hubcap straight off. To put on the fresh hubcap, align it precisely and snap it tightly into place. If working on a vehicle without sufficient ground space , use a hoist and jack stands for safety . For more tricky situations, consider seeking a skilled mechanic .
